Put my freedom tops back on today with the Spiderweb shade. Wasn't very difficult at all. Just had to pull back one section at a time and get my hands under the shade to lock the tops in. Pretty easy to be honest with you. Plan on leaving the shade on till the winter...Yes, that's what they say. I'll reply with pics/experience when we put our hardtop and panels back on.

I'm pretty sure this antenna is only for FM and AM. XM is satellite and needs a completely different type of antenna that is likely permanently mounted somewhere. Not sure where yet (my JLU comes next week).
From my reading on the topic here, people have said that ALL stubby antennas have diminished reception over the factory one... just a question of how much you can tolerate in stations that are lost. For me, I very rarely listen to AM & FM... almost always streaming from phone or satellite radio, so I'm not too worried about a smaller antenna that will cause some loss of signal.
